The Journey of Adjustment


We spend most of our lives interacting with people in one way or another, but we mostly don’t know what it means to relate. Whether at the level of business, social activities or family life, managing relationships takes skill and practice. Intelligent co-operation with your business partner, investor or employees is one of the key factors to your startup success.


Our biggest problems arise in our relationships, whether in personal or business. Therefore, to find fulfillment, we need first to learn a different way of relating – a way that keeps us in touch with our own values and our deepest aspirations. Conflicts arise anyway – how you approach and handle the challenge makes the difference. Being aware of yourself will help you to become a better leader. 


The .Cocoon program participants were guided to find their own insights through dialogue and practice, they learned to see the other as a reflection of their own behavior, a mirror that supports them to improve the quality of their relationships and business, by changing their own behavior and thus themselves. They learned the difference in approaches between men and women and the power that lies within that, including how to use it; how to handle their emotions effectively, stop compromising themselves and to grow from conflict.

About Elizabeth 

Seeker by heart and apprentice of the late Théun Mares, started her career as a Chartered Accountant. She was Financial Director of a multi-national company subsidiary for many years. As she reached the height of her career, and as her work brought her into touch with an increasingly wide cross-section of people, Elizabeth began to realize that her talents and fate did not lie in the corporate world but in helping people to help themselves. In 1991 she embarked upon a new journey, first of all, training in the humanitarian disciplines, and then in 1996 becoming a full-time teacher.

Elizabeth has a simple, honest and highly practical approach in guiding people to look within their unique life experiences to find their own answers. This approach is immensely uplifting and empowering since you will learn how to solve any problem or challenge that comes your way.
